What can we learn from the warnings in Matthew 7 about false religion?
Answered in 1 source
Matthew 7 warns that false religion is dangerously deceptive, leading many to believe they know Christ when they do not.
The warnings in Matthew 7 serve as a sobering reminder of the reality of false religion. Jesus cautions that many will claim to prophesy and perform miracles in His name, yet they will ultimately be rejected because they lack a genuine relationship with Him (Matthew 7:21-23). This illustrates that mere religious activity or outward appearances cannot substitute for true faith and obedience. The passage emphasizes the need for self-examination among believers to ensure that their faith is genuine and grounded in a true understanding and relationship with Christ, as false religion can lead to eternal separation from Him.
